When Your Pittsburgh Chimney Sweep Reveals Issues
Pittsburgh's river-valley climate drives interior chimney problems that sweeping reveals. Common findings include: moisture-damaged mortar joints from persistent humidity, cracked flue tiles from Pittsburgh's 55-70 freeze-thaw cycles, industrial-era brick deterioration behind the liner, and condensation damage in cold, north-facing hillside chimneys. Mount Washington and hillside properties face particularly aggressive moisture conditions. We document everything with camera footage and provide honest repair guidance.

Creosote Buildup in Pittsburgh Chimneys
Pittsburgh's river-valley environment creates aggressive creosote conditions. Cold, damp winters keep chimney walls at low temperatures — maximizing condensation when warm flue gases rise. The Three Rivers' persistent humidity adds moisture to combustion gases, producing stickier deposits. Hillside chimneys exposed to north-facing cold accumulate deposits faster than protected locations. Annual sweeping prevents dangerous buildup, and heavy wood-burners should consider mid-winter cleaning during Pittsburgh's extended cold season.
